Problem Phenomenon and Cause Analysis
When developing web applications with the Bootstrap framework, developers frequently encounter issues where modal dialogs are obscured by their backdrop. Specifically, after clicking the trigger button, modal content fails to display properly above the backdrop and is completely covered.
Analysis of problem cases reveals that this phenomenon typically stems from the complexity of stacking contexts in DOM structures. When modals are nested within parent containers with position: absolute, position: relative, or position: fixed properties, even if high z-index values are set for the modals, their actual display order may still be constrained by the parent container's z-index.
Bootstrap's modal system consists of two main components: the .modal-backdrop overlay and the .modal dialog content. In standard implementations, the backdrop is inserted at the root level of the DOM tree, while modal content may reside within complex nested structures. This separation in DOM positioning causes z-index comparisons to no longer occur within the same stacking context, leading to display abnormalities.
Core Solution: Adjusting DOM Structure
The most effective and recommended solution is to move the modal's HTML code to the top level of the document. The specific implementation is as follows:
<body>
<!-- Main page content -->
<div id="main-content">
<!-- Various page elements -->
<button class="btn btn-primary" data-toggle="modal" data-target="#exampleModal">
Open Modal
</button>
</div>
<!-- Modal defined as direct child of body -->
<div class="modal fade" id="exampleModal" tabindex="-1" role="dialog">
<div class="modal-dialog" role="document">
<div class="modal-content">
<div class="modal-header">
<h5 class="modal-title">Example Title</h5>
<button type="button" class="close" data-dismiss="modal">
<span>×</span>
</button>
</div>
<div class="modal-body">
<p>Modal content area</p>
</div>
<div class="modal-footer">
<button type="button" class="btn btn-secondary" data-dismiss="modal">Close</button>
<button type="button" class="btn btn-primary">Save changes</button>
</div>
</div>
</div>
</div>
</body>This layout ensures that the modal and backdrop reside in the same stacking context environment, allowing normal z-index comparisons. Bootstrap's official documentation explicitly recommends this approach to prevent interference from other components on modal display effects.
Alternative Approaches and Applicable Scenarios
In situations where DOM structure cannot be modified, developers may consider the following alternatives:
Adjusting z-index Values: Override the z-index properties of modals and backdrops via CSS. Note that this method may vary depending on specific layouts, and using !important declarations is recommended to ensure priority:
.modal-backdrop {
z-index: 1040 !important;
}
.modal-content {
z-index: 1050 !important;
}Removing Positioning Properties: Inspect and remove position property settings from modal parent containers. In some simple layouts, eliminating the creation of stacking contexts can resolve display issues.
JavaScript Dynamic Adjustment: Use jQuery or native JavaScript to dynamically adjust modal position or z-index values when the modal is shown. This method is suitable for dynamically generated page content:
$('#exampleModal').on('show.bs.modal', function() {
$(this).css('z-index', 1060);
});Practical Recommendations and Considerations
In actual development, prioritizing the solution of placing modals as body root elements is advised. This method offers the best compatibility and stability, adapting to various complex page layouts.
For projects using front-end frameworks (e.g., Angular, React, Vue.js), attention should be paid to the DOM positioning of component rendering. Utilize portal functionality or similar mechanisms provided by the framework to ensure modal components are rendered to correct DOM locations.
When debugging such issues, browser developer tools are invaluable resources. Inspecting DOM structures via the Elements panel and viewing computed style values through the Styles panel can quickly identify the root cause of problems.
Finally, keeping Bootstrap versions updated is also an important measure to prevent such issues. New versions typically fix known layout compatibility problems and provide more stable component behavior.
